I haven’t seen anyone else come close to 13 rides on SDD
Wow! Well, if I had any tips for how to accomplish the same thing,

- I would suggest going on a night that isn't sold out.
- Do everything else that you want to do first. Short lines elsewhere allowed us to do ToT x 4, Star Tours x 4, RnRC x 1, and snacks between 7 and 10pm.
- Save ol' Slink for the last portion of the night. Lines were longer earlier, and shorter later.
- Don't stray from the ride, at least not much... This isn't for everyone, as riding 13 consecutive times won't be fun if you'd rather do something else.
- Have good luck, and hope for no downtime.
